Understanding Basic Allowance for Subsistence (BAS)

BAS is a monthly food allowance paid to service members to offset the cost of meals. Unlike BAH, BAS rates are uniform across all duty locations and do not vary by geographic area.
  • Enlisted BAS is higher than officer BAS because officers historically had access to subsidized dining facilities less frequently
  • BAS rates are adjusted annually based on the USDA food cost index, typically increasing by 1% to 3% per year
  • Service members on full meal plans in government dining facilities may have BAS reduced or collected as a meal deduction
  • BAS is not taxable income, making it a valuable component of total military compensation

Check your Leave and Earnings Statement to verify your current BAS rate and any meal deductions being applied.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the current BAS rates?

This tool uses approximate example rates for planning. Real BAS values are published annually by the DoD and typically increase each January based on food cost changes.

Do officers and enlisted receive different BAS?

Yes. Enlisted members receive a higher monthly BAS than officers. The difference is approximately $100 per month, though exact amounts are updated annually.

Is BAS affected by where I am stationed?

No. Unlike BAH, BAS rates are the same regardless of duty station location. Every service member of the same category (enlisted or officer) receives the same BAS amount.

What is a meal deduction?

Service members who eat at government dining facilities may have a portion of their BAS collected as a meal deduction. The amount depends on whether you are on a full, partial, or no meal plan.

Is BAS taxable?

No. BAS is a non-taxable allowance, meaning it does not appear as taxable income on your W-2. This makes the effective value of BAS higher than the dollar amount suggests.
